タグ

WordPressに関するRewishのブックマーク (53)

  • Nginxを使ったもう一歩進んだWordPressチューニング

    Nginxを使ったWordPressのチューニングといえば、フロントエンドNginxとバックエンドのNginx(もしくはApache)に分けてproxy cacheを効かせるのが王道です。 さらにWP Super Cacheプラグインを利用してなるべくPHPMySQLにアクセスさせないようにすると、手軽で絶大なパフォーマンスアップが可能です。 今回はそこからもう一歩進めたチューニングについて書きたいと思います。 二段階層を廃したシンプルな構成 まずは、図をご覧ください。 前述の王道チューニングの構成はA図となります。 proxy cacheはNginxがバックエンドのサーバーに処理を回し、返ってきたレスポンスをキャッシュして、Nginx自身がキャッシュを返すことでパフォーマンスを上げる仕組みです。 A図-1がキャッシュの無いアクセス、A図-2がキャッシュが効いているアクセスを表していま

    Nginxを使ったもう一歩進んだWordPressチューニング
  • WP Questions

    Ask your WordPress questions! Pay money and get answers fast! Recently Solved Questions view all Question Prize Ended At woocommerce order splitting $20 2022-09-15 wp query with multiple of same meta keys $25 2022-07-23 Display post loop associated with current category url slug $25 2022-05-24 Order posts by ACF checkbox $25 2022-04-29 I need to create a custom dropdown field but i need the values

  • WordPressをもっと便利にするスニペットが500個以上登録されている -WPSNIPP

    WordPressにちょっと機能を追加したい時に役立つスニペットをまとめたサイトを紹介します。 目的をもって探すだけでなく、こんなこともできるのかという発見もあるかもしれません。 WPSNIPP – 500+ WordPress code snippets for your blog [ad#ad-2] WPSNIPPでは現在、545個のWordPressの便利なスニペットが登録されています。 下記にほんのちょっとだけ、その便利なスニペットをピックアップしました。 よく使うショートコードをボタンから選択可能に 特定のページのみ特定のスタイルシートを適用 アーカイブウィジェットの表示期間を制限する Google+1ボタンを設置する プラグインを管理画面を使わずに停止する CSSファイルのキャッシュを防止する 大切な「wp-config.php」を守る よく使うショートコードをボタンから選択可

  • デザインどや!?|海外カジノ オンラインのWEB作成

    Webページレイアウト、ナビゲーションプラグイン、フォーム、スライダー&カルーセルプラグイン、チャート&グラフプラグイン、イメージエフェクトプラグイン、ビデオプラグインなど。チェックしておきたいです。海外カジノ オンラインサイトの制作はワードプレスのプラグインを利用して様々な機能を付け加えて完成させることができます。2012年のjQueryプラグインまとめでは、デザインの一新や個別のカスタムにも対応した国際的で魅力的なサイト作成に役立つ情報を紹介しています。

  • よくあるカスタマイズコード functions.php 多め

    WordPress のテーマを自作するときに、よく使っているコードのまとめです。主に functions.php に書いている基的なコードばかりです。私は仕事で Webサイトを作っているので、後半はクライアントさん向けの Webサイト用コードです。 私、Evernote を使ってるんですけど、WordPress をカスタマイズするコード … たくさんクリップしてあって、ちょっとごちゃごちゃしてきたので整理しました … X( その中から一般的に使えるコードだけまとめてみました。個人的によく使うコードなど、一カ所にまとめておきたいなーと思ったのでメモ書きです。全部 WordPress 3.2 になってから、テスト済みです。 WordPress のよくあるカスタマイズ 目次 セッティング関連 ソーシャルボタンを追加 抜粋表示、the_excerpt 関連 タイトルの文字数を制限して表示する 特

  • WordPressの管理ページをより便利にカスタマイズする方法13

    2014年8月22日 Wordpress WordPressを使ってWebサイトを作る際、自分のサイトならさほど気にならない管理画面も、クライアントに納品するのであれば少し手を加えて使いやすくしておきたいところ。少しデザインを変えるだけ、機能を追加・削除するだけで「オリジナル感」がでますよね。今回はそんなWordPressの裏側、管理ページのカスタマイズ方法を紹介します。 ↑私が10年以上利用している会計ソフト! WordPressの管理ページをカスタマイズ 目次 管理バーを消す コメントに「削除」「スパム」ボタンを追加 ログイン画面:ロゴを変更する ログイン画面:CSSを変更する 管理画面左上の「W」ロゴマークを変更 投稿画面の項目を非表示 サイドバーのメニューを非表示に フッターテキストを変更 ユーザープロフィールの項目を追加 ビジュアルリッチエディターを非表示 投稿画面のビジュアルリ

    WordPressの管理ページをより便利にカスタマイズする方法13
    Rewish
    Rewish 2011/05/19
    こんなにいじくり回せるんだ。
  • WordPressを100倍速くする! MySQLの調整やnginx proxy cache | KRAY Inc

    [追記1] 最後で説明しているproxy cacheの設定を修正しました。 [追記2] nginx proxy cacheでキャッシュしない場合の処理を変更しました。 [追記3] スマートフォンや携帯で閲覧した時にキャッシュしない設定を追加しました。 はじめに 大げさな題名ですが、今回はWordPress単体を速くするのではなく、データベースやWebサーバなどの調整、またnginxのproxy cache機能を使って速くする話になります。 サイトの構成によっては、proxy cacheは使えないかもしれませんが、使わなくても5倍程度速くすることはできましたので、参考にしていただければと思います。 今回行うチューニング一覧 DBを最適化するプラグインを導入する APCを導入してPHPを速くする MySQLを速くする 重いWordPressプラグインを外す nginx+FastCGIにする W

    WordPressを100倍速くする! MySQLの調整やnginx proxy cache | KRAY Inc
  • [WordPress] ユニットテストができるプラグイン wp-unit | Nullyのぶろぐ

    昨日、当ブログ管理画面でちょこちょこ遊んでいたら管理画面からユニットテストを実行できるプラグインを発見したので、紹介がてら簡単な使い方のご紹介。 wp-unit wp-unitPHPUnitをベースとして作られたユニットテストプラグインです。 PHPUnitについての説明は割愛します。 PHPUnitをインストールする場合、現在利用しているPHPのバージョンに合わせてインストールして下さい。(4.3.0以上であればOKっぽいです) ※予めPHPUnitへパスを通しておく必要があります。 インストール 管理画面ログイン後、「プラグイン」メニューから新規追加を選択します。 検索ワードに「wp-unit」と入力し、検索します。 表示された画面から「wp-unit」を探します。 「インストール」をクリックし、インストールを終えます。 インストール完了後は以下のメニューが追加され、ユニットテストが

    Rewish
    Rewish 2011/01/14
    うほーマジっすか。
  • 多数デバイスに対応させる事も可能なモバイル自動対応WordPressプラグイン・WPtap - かちびと.net

    iPhoneに対応させるWPプラグインは 結構あります。例えばよく見かけるのは WPtouchです。しかし、ちゃんと探せば 更に高機能且つ、手軽なプラグインも あります。WPtap もその一つ。日で 紹介している記事は皆無ですが、非常に 機能の充実したプラグインです。 僕も昨日知ったばかりで、iPhoneiPadでしか確認をしていないので、タイトルで「多数デバイスに対応」と言い切ってしまうのは微妙な気がしたのですが、釣ってでも知ってほしいプラグインだったのでご了承頂ければと思います。じゃあ日曜に記事公開するなよって話ですがw iPhoneだけでなく、iPadAndroidBlackBerry、Nokia S60+などに対応しており、対応デバイスを追加することも出来ます。 [note]【2011・01・10 追記】 このブログに導入しました。iPhone等でアクセスすれば表示チェック

  • WordPressプラグイン「BuddyPress」でSNSサイトを作成

    2017年6月29日 Wordpress SNS(ソーシャルネットワーキングサイト)でユーザー同士がコミュニケーションを取れるサイトを作りたい!そんな時に役立つのがWordPressプラグイン「BuddyPress」。メンバーになると友達の申請やメッセージの交換、グループ(コミュニティ)の作成など、Mixiライクなサイトを作ることができます。さらにWordPress3.0のマルチサイト設定をすれば各メンバーがブログの作成可能!そんな便利なプラグインを紹介します。 ↑私が10年以上利用している会計ソフト! BuddyPressでSNSサイトを構築 目次 BuddyPressでなにができるの? BuddyPressをインストールする WordPress3.0でマルチサイトの設定 フォーラムを追加する BuddyPressのテーマを変更する 1. BuddyPressでなにができるの? Word

    WordPressプラグイン「BuddyPress」でSNSサイトを作成
    Rewish
    Rewish 2010/07/06
    ほー凄いな
  • GAE上でWordPressを動かす (1/3)- @IT

    第6回 GAE上でWordPressを動かす 萩原 巧 リトルソフト株式会社 中越 智哉 株式会社ナレッジエックス 2010/6/3 今回は趣向を変えて、PHPで書かれていて広く普及しているブログ作成アプリケーション「WordPress」をGAE上で動かしてみます(編集部) 連載6回目にあたる今回は、今までとは少し趣向を変えて、実際に広く使われているPHPのオープンソースソフトウェアがGAE上で動作するかについての検証を行い、動作の実現性や問題点について言及するとともに、画面表示やデータベースアクセスを含めた動作について検証を行っていく過程を通して、PHPのアプリケーションをGAE上で動作させるために必要となるテクニックなどを紹介していきます。 GAEにインストールするアプリケーションについて GAE上にて動作検証を行うアプリケーションとして、星の数ほど(大げさですが...)存在するPHP

  • WordPressでAutoPagerizeを有効にする、WP-AutoPagerizeプラグイン :: 5509

    以前に作ったWordPressプラグイン「WP-AutoPagerize」ほぼ書き直して作り直したので、新しいものとして公開します。変更点を書いても仕方がないので主な要件を書いておきます。けっこう色んな環境で使えるようにしたつもりです。 jQuery不要 管理画面からオプションの変更ができる 自動読み込みに加え、ボタン(リンク)クリックで読み込むオプション ページ番号を追加しないオプション ページ読み込み前の処理をJSで追加できるようにした ページ読み込み後の処理(コールバック)をJSで追加できるようにした 動作サンプルもあります。 ダウンロード WP-AutoPagerize (WordPress Plugin Direcory) インストール WP-AutoPagerizeディレクトリをpluginsディレクトリにコピー 管理画面のプラグインからアクティベート テンプレートに と がな

  • [wp] WordPressテーマのfunctions.phpに仕込まれるワームについて

    配布されたテーマをアクティブにしたことがありますか?もしあるなら既に悪意あるコードが仕込まれているかもしれませんよ。 2chWordPress (ワードプレス) その15 >>806 より テーマの安全性のチェックとかってみなさんどうしてますか? WPとテーマをいくつかいれてから、システム情報みてみたらメールキューがたまってた。 あれ?と思ってキューにたまってるメールみてみたら上記アドレスあてにブログのアドレスを送ろうとしてました。 OB25通る設定してないのでひっかかってたから助かりました。 送ってるファイルの正体はSimple Perfectというテーマのfunction.phpです。 http://kachibito.net/wordpress/free-high-quality-themes.htmlで紹介されてました。 該当アドレスが分割して組み込まれてました。送ろうとしていた

    [wp] WordPressテーマのfunctions.phpに仕込まれるワームについて
  • クライアントへの納品時につけたいWordPressプラグイン9 – creamu

    WordPressでサイトを構築してクライアントに納品する。 そんなときにおすすめなのが、『9 Plugins Your Clients Will Love For Their WordPress Website』。クライアントへの納品時につけたいWordPressプラグイン集です。 かなり便利そうなのが揃っています。クライアントに渡す際には、管理画面のデザイン等もカスタマイズしたいですよね。 My Brand ログインページをオリジナルのデザイン・レイアウトにカスタマイズできる。ロゴをクライアントのロゴにするなど Branded Admin 管理画面のヘッダとフッタを、オリジナルのデザインにできる Ozh Admin Drop Down Menu 管理画面の左サイドバーのメニューはクリックしてサブメニューを開きますが、それを水平のドロップダウンメニューに変更でき、マウスオーバー&ワンクリ

  • WPのパフォーマンスを改善してみようか | gaspanik weblog

    のWeb業界でもそろそろサイトの表示パフォーマンスをどうにかしなきゃなぁ…と考えている方もいらっしゃることでしょう(ごく一部かもしれませんが 笑)。いわゆる普通のWebサイトの表示パフォーマンスの改善については、ここでも年末から数回にわたって取り上げています。 Webサイトの高速化的な話をWD誌でYSlow!、使ってわかるあんなことこんなことPage Speedでチェックついでに最適化Page Speedが1.6βになったようでここのエントリーに挙げた以外に、ちょっと前にゲリラ的にUSTREAMでくっちゃべってみたところ反響も大きかったようです(最初の回は特に他のどこ探してもないことも言いましたしね、フフフ)。 で、今回はこのブログでも使っているWordPressのパフォーマンスをアップさせるためにできることをいくつか紹介したいと思います。「できる」「できない」は設置されている環境で異

    WPのパフォーマンスを改善してみようか | gaspanik weblog
  • WordPressのパーマリンクを日付ベースにする方法 - Rewish

    WordPressのパーマリンクを/YYYY/MM/DD/hhmmの様な日付ベースにしようとすると、日付アーカイブになってしまい記事単体のページとして認識されません。 秒まで設定(/YYYY/MM/DD/hhmmssなど)すれば記事単体のページとして認識されますが、微妙に長くなってしまうので見た目もちょっと・・・ですよね。 と言う訳で今回は、半ば強引にパーマリンクを日付ベースにしてみたいと思います。 日付ベースのパーマリンクを有効にするコード 以下のコードをテーマファイルの何処か(functions.phpなど)に記述。 <?php add_action('parse_query', 'date_base_permalink'); function date_base_permalink($wp_query) { $q = (object)$wp_query->query_vars; //

    WordPressのパーマリンクを日付ベースにする方法 - Rewish
    Rewish
    Rewish 2010/03/05
  • WordCamp WordCamp Japan � Home

    WordCampとは WordCamp はローカルコミュニティが運営するカジュアルなスタイルのカンファレンスです。
世界中で7500万以上のサイトで使われている無料のオープンソース・パブリッシング・ソフトウェア、WordPress に関連する様々なトピックが扱われています。 WordCamp にはブログ初心者から WordPress のプロフェッショナル、コンサルタントまで幅広い参加者がいます。
スピーチセッションやライトニングトーク、その他様々なアクティビティが用意されており、多彩なコンテンツが楽しめます。

    WordCamp WordCamp Japan � Home
  • WordCamp Fukuoka 2010最速レポート(随時更新) | gihyo.jp

    2010年2月27日、日で4回目、九州地区では初となるWordPressに特化したカンファレンス「WordCamp Fukuoka 2010」が西南学院大学コミュニティーセンターにて開催された。ここでは、その模様について速報でお届けする。 ※順次公開していきます。 会場となった西南学院大学コミュニティーセンター。 開会に先立ち挨拶を述べる株式会社ヌーラボ代表取締役橋正徳氏。福岡で働くWebの人々(FWW)などの運営にも関わっている。 WordPress for the world from Japan~日から世界へ オープニングセッションを務めたのは、ニューヨークを拠点とした情報システムコンサルティング会社1080dの最高情報責任者で、アメリカの最大手出版社であるTime社でWordPressを使った様々なオンラインメディアサイトに関わる立場でもあるNed Watson氏。同氏は5~

    WordCamp Fukuoka 2010最速レポート(随時更新) | gihyo.jp
  • Buy and Sell WordPress Plugins at WP Plugins

    Welcome to WP Plugins, your personal brokers in the WordPress plugin marketplace. How to get started buying and selling WordPress plugins Registering as a buyer or seller at WP Plugins is 100% free. All that we ask is that if you are a seller we are able to confirm that you own the plugin you are selling. And if you are a buyer you provide ID and agree to confidentiality. How the process works Let

  • 簡単な作業でWordPressのセキュリティをアップするチップス

    ブログツール「WordPress」のインストール時に、簡単な作業でセキュリティをアップするチップスをWP Engineerから紹介します。 Small Security Tipps for your WordPress Install 以下、そのポイントを意訳したものです。 はじめに WordPressの標準のインストールは非常に簡単で、WordPressの人気の要因の一つともいえます。しかしながら、インストールを行う際に少し手を加えることで、不正なアクセスをより難しいものにすることができます。 テーブルのプレフィックス DBで使用するテーブルのプレフィックスを標準の「wp_」から異なる文字列に変更します。 設定方法 「wp-config.php」の「$table_prefix = 'wp_';」の「wp_」を変更します。 認証用ユニークキー WordPressの安全性をアップするために、

    Rewish
    Rewish 2009/11/11
    robots.txtのやつはrobots.txt自体を除かれるとバレるので逆効果な気がする。